Nearly 600 distribution customers recently joined Infor's employees and partners at Inforum 2013 to network, collaborate, and learn. "This was a very important year for us," said Andy Berry, VP and GM of Infor's distribution business unit. "It was the first time since 2008 that distribution customers fully participated in Inforum, and the feedback has been overwhelmingly positive." The distribution team created a "conference-within-a-conference" atmosphere that included over 100 distribution-specific sessions, 30 speed sessions in the Hub, and the opportunity for 14 Special Interest Groups (SIG) to meet. Infor is celebrating VISUAL’s 20 years of innovation, and longtime customer Major Tool & Machine is pretty happy about it, too. Major Tool & Machine has been using and upgrading the manufacturing-centric software since 1996—practically from Infor VISUAL’s beginning. The two have grown together. Based in Indianapolis, Major Tool & Machine delivers world-class manufacturing, engineering, fabrication, machining, and assembly services to a variety of global customers and industries. Every two years, Modern Healthcare selects the Top 25 Women in Healthcare. The recognition program honors exceptional female healthcare executives who are making a positive difference in the industry. Five Infor Healthcare customers are on the 2013 list: Judith Persichilli, CEO of Catholic Health East Shirley Weis, chief administrative officer and vice president of the Mayo Clinic Marna Borgstrom, president and CEO of Yale-New Haven Hospital and Health System Sharon O’Keefe, president of the University of Chicago Medical Center Nancy Schlichting, president and CEO of Detroit’s Henry Ford Health System The recognition is an impressive achievement. By Edward Talerico, Infor Aerospace and Defense Strategy Director Possible US defense department budget cuts loom over the A&D industry with a paralyzing gloom. Uncertainty is causing some cautious manufacturers, contractors and suppliers to delay major investments. Upgrading the IT infrastructure is sometimes put on the “wait and see” list of investments. Because the A&D industry is rapidly changing and requiring new business models to keep pace, this investment delay can have serious repercussions.
